Not going to lie, when I saw sea-ogre, I immediately got worried this wasn’t for me. I kept picturing Shrek with fins in my head but my friends and I have a saying “In Ruby we trust� so we jumped right in trusting one of our favorite authors. I am so glad we decided to read it because I truly believe RD has such a beautiful creative mind.

I fell in love with the misunderstood Ranan. His grumpiness cracked me up but deep down he is very sweet.

Then we have Vali who has had a terrible life that leads her into a chance meeting with Ranan that changes her circumstances. Unfortunately, even escaping captivity with your new hot, beefy 4 armed partner on the back of a huge turtle still doesn’t convince her that she hasn’t traded one capture for another.

Watching them try to navigate a relationship with spouse of a different species that they don’t know much about all while struggling to communicate was a fun and enjoyable experience.

I am also eager to know more about the seakind in this book if RD decides to expand this world.
